postgresql 安装libxml2库
时间: 2023-11-15 14:56:06 浏览: 42
要在 PostgreSQL 中使用 libxml2 库,需要先安装 libxml2 库及其开发包。可以使用以下命令在 Ubuntu 系统上安装:
```
sudo apt-get install libxml2 libxml2-dev
```
安装完成后,重新编译 PostgreSQL,使其支持 libxml2 库。具体步骤如下:
1. 下载 PostgreSQL 源码包并解压缩。
2. 进入解压缩后的目录,执行以下命令:
```
./configure --with-libxml --with-libxslt
```
这个命令会检查系统中是否已经安装了 libxml2 和 libxslt 库,并将它们加入到 PostgreSQL 的编译选项中。
3. 执行以下命令进行编译和安装:
```
make
sudo make install
```
这个命令会编译 PostgreSQL 并将其安装到系统中。
完成以上步骤后,就可以在 PostgreSQL 中使用 libxml2 库了。
相关问题
postgresql13安装postgis
安装 PostGIS 前,需要确保已经安装了 PostgreSQL。安装 PostgreSQL 13 可以参考官方文档:https://www.postgresql.org/download/。
安装 PostGIS 需要执行以下步骤:
1. 安装 PostGIS 的依赖项:
```
sudo apt-get install libgeos-dev libproj-dev libgdal-dev libxml2-dev libjson-c-dev libcunit1-dev libprotobuf-c-dev protobuf-c-compiler
```
2. 安装 PostGIS:
```
sudo apt-get install postgresql-13-postgis-3
```
3. 在 PostgreSQL 中启用 PostGIS:
```
sudo -u postgres psql
CREATE EXTENSION postgis;
CREATE EXTENSION postgis_topology;
```
以上步骤完成后,PostGIS 就已经在 PostgreSQL 中安装完成了。您可以使用以下命令检查 PostGIS 是否已成功安装:
```
sudo -u postgres psql -c "SELECT postgis_version();"
```
postgresql14.6安装postgis
要在 PostgreSQL 14.6 上安装 PostGIS,您需要按照以下步骤进行操作:
1. 首先,确保您已经安装了 PostgreSQL 14.6,并且已经有一个可用的数据库实例。
2. 接下来,您需要安装 PostGIS 扩展。使用以下命令安装 PostGIS 的依赖项:
```
sudo apt-get install libgdal-dev libproj-dev libjson-c-dev libxml2-dev libgeos-dev liblwgeom-dev
```
3. 然后,使用以下命令安装 PostGIS 扩展:
```
sudo apt-get install postgresql-14-postgis-3
```
4. 安装完成后,通过以下命令启用 PostGIS 扩展:
```
sudo -u postgres psql -c "CREATE EXTENSION postgis; CREATE EXTENSION postgis_raster;"
```
这将在当前数据库中启用 PostGIS 扩展。
5. 现在,您可以使用 PostGIS 的功能在 PostgreSQL 中进行地理空间数据的存储和查询。
这些步骤适用于基于 Ubuntu 的系统,如果您使用其他 Linux 发行版,请相应地调整命令。如果您使用的是其他操作系统,请参考相应的文档进行安装。
希望这可以帮助您成功安装 PostGIS。如果您有其他问题,请随时提问!